### "Leveraging Applications Manager for full stack application performance observability "

October 25, 2024

4.0

Applications Manager's full stack observability in a single plane simplifies monitoring by quickening incident response with their root cause analysis feature. With our distributed architecture for our business applications, Applications Manager was able to provide a single pane to view the different metrics and attribute status of the entire environment. Starting monitoring from the infrastructure servers where the applications are installed, you can review resource utilization, to the respective application technologies like databases where you can get notified immediately if a specific scheduled job fails to run, and the web apps and app servers, finally to the actual end user experience where you can confirm the service delivery to the end user through synthetic and transactional monitoring. Applications Manager provides all this visibility which brings application performance monitoring to the next level

Pros

Support for the full stack monitoring and also readily available templates for different technologies which simplifies onboarding and monitoring. Transactional monitoring with APM Insight which fully monitors any activity going through your application and shares important insights and metrics which are a clear indicator of the application performance.

Cons

Failure to support monitoring for ATM related attributes like cash trays details. We can easily monitor ATM availability but cannot pick up on details like tray jams, or empty trays.

### "ManageEngine Application Manager: A Comprehensive Performance Monitoring Solution"

December 2, 2024

5.0

ManageEngine Application Manager is a cost effective and feature rich monitoring tool offering comprehensive coverage of servers, application, database, and hybrid environments with real time tracking, root cause analysis and customizable dashboards. It is user friendly for basic setups but can require technical expertise for advanced customization and integration. While is provides reliable supports and resource, users may face challenges with performance in large setups, alerting system, customization and less modern UI.

Pros

Comprehensive Monitoring: It Supports diverse applications and technologies, including web servers, databases, cloud services, ERP systems, and more. Also, an End-to-End Visibility Offers insights into all layers, from infrastructure to applications.

Cons

Complexity in Advanced Configuration: There is a steep Learning Curve for Advanced Features while the basic setup is simple, configuring advanced monitoring, custom scripts, or integrations can be challenging for some users. And Script-Based Customization requires technical expertise for creating or modifying custom scripts.
